ClamWin uses the scanning engine and virus signature database provided by the Clam AV project (now owned by Cisco). If any files are detected falsely as infected by ClamWin (false positives), you should report them to Clam AV so they can correct their signature. The Clam AV web page is at http://www.clamav.net/lang/en/ on the world wide web. From the menu options, select to report a file. Then be sure to select to report a false positive--do not select to submit a malware sample. Clam AV will correct their false positive signature manually, so it can take a few days. To speed things up, I suggest you also upload the file to Virus Total, and I think they will also submit the file to Clam AV, so there will be more people reporting the false positive. Until the false positive is corrected, you can whitelist the file(s) in ClamWin's configuration menu--Tools, Preferences, Filters, Exclude Matching Filenames.

Earlier posts mention that ClamWin uses the scan engine and virus signatures provided by the Clam AV project. It says that you should contact Clam AV about false positive detections. It says that you should send Clam AV a copy of the false positive file via their normal false positive submission process. Also upload a copy of the file to Virus Total and scan it there. If a file is detected as a Potentially Unwanted Program (PUP), Clam AV has a policy of not correcting false positive detections on PUPs because the PUP detection is an optional detection selected by the user.
